1)Slice and toast it then top with cheese whiz. Yummy! Or, 2)make a breakfast Fritatta- in a pie dish put a layer of cubed sourdough bread. Top with shredded cheese of choice, add some diced ham or bacon, diced seeded tomatoes and some sliced scallions, greens and all. In a bowl scramble about 4 raw eggs with about 1/4 cup milk and a pinch of salt and pepper. Pour it over the bread and cheese mixture and bake it in the oven at 325 until the center is cooked. Very good. kind of like a mix between quiche and omelet!. French Toast with sourdough bread is great.





Combine whole eggs and evaporated milk ( the amounts vary depending on how many pieces of toast you are making)


I use 2 eggs for 1 cup milk


Dip bread slices in egg/milk mixture


Melt butter (2-3 T) in skillet until hot


Fry bread ( 2 pieces at a time) in skillet until light brown and crispy


Sprinkle toast with cinnamon and powdered sugar or lemon juice and powdered sugar
eggs in a nest. cut or pull out a round ';hole'; in the middle of a piece of buttered bread. place bread in a skillet on medium heat. put a pat of butter in the hole and crack an egg into the hole. cook on medium-low heat.till egg is set being careful not to burn bread.
